Day 2: Monday, November 26, 2018
Charleston

Known as the Holy City, Charleston has survived the Civil War, major fires, an earthquake and hurricanes-and still exudes elegance, charm and grace. A local guide will show you the city highlighting the many historic homes and restored buildings adorned with delightful 18th-century Christmas decorations Stop at the battery overlooking Fort Sumter where, on april 12, 1861, the first shots of the Civil War were fired. Continue on to City Market, one of the oldest public markets in America. Meet a local artisan to learn about the tradition of weaving Gullah sweetgrass baskets, one of the oldest handicrafts in the United States. following your city tour, the choice is yours! Perhaps you will choose to explore Boone Hall Plantation where you'll experience southern plantation living as yo come to know one of America's oldest working plantations. Or, you may opt to explore Patriots Point Naval & Maritime Museum where you'' board the impressive USS Yorktown aircraft carrier and walk in the footsteps of sailors and officers as you tour the flight deck; you;ll also have time at the Congressional Medal of Honor Museum and marvel at the largest collection of military aircraft in the United States. This evening, join your fellow travelers for a welcome dinner at a local restaurant before visiting James Island County Park, where over 500,000 lights provide you with an enchanting 3-mile driving tour.
